Fresh Late Summer Vegetables for Your Table

The harvest season’s final abundance, typically from August through September, offers a unique array of produce. Examples include juicy tomatoes still ripening on the vine, sweet corn bursting with flavor, and vibrant peppers reaching their peak heat. Root vegetables like carrots and potatoes mature to their full size, and squashes and pumpkins begin their ascent toward autumnal prominence. This period bridges the gap between summer’s bounty and the arrival of fall crops.

These crops represent a valuable source of nutrients and culinary versatility. Their availability often coincides with a period of lower prices, making them accessible to a wider range of consumers. Historically, these harvests played a vital role in preserving food for the winter months through canning, pickling, and other methods. This practice ensured communities had access to vital nutrients during colder seasons when fresh produce was scarce.

1. Peak Season Flavors

Peak season flavors represent the culmination of optimal growing conditions throughout the summer months. Extended periods of sunshine, warmth, and adequate rainfall allow late summer vegetables to develop complex sugars and robust flavor profiles. This phenomenon is particularly evident in tomatoes, where varieties like heirloom and beefsteak reach their peak sweetness and juiciness during this period. Similarly, sweet corn achieves its maximum sugar content, resulting in a distinctly sweeter and more tender kernel. The intensity of flavors in peppers, from bell peppers to chili peppers, also intensifies during late summer.

This heightened flavor concentration offers significant culinary advantages. Dishes featuring these ingredients require less seasoning and enhancement, allowing the natural flavors of the vegetables to shine. A simple tomato salad with fresh basil and mozzarella highlights the rich sweetness of a peak-season tomato, while grilled corn on the cob needs little more than a touch of butter and salt to showcase its inherent sweetness. The vibrant flavors of late summer vegetables elevate even simple recipes, making them ideal for showcasing seasonal cuisine.

Understanding the connection between peak season and flavor intensity allows consumers to make informed choices, maximizing the enjoyment and nutritional benefits derived from these vegetables. Seeking out locally sourced produce during its peak season not only supports local farmers but also ensures access to the most flavorful and nutritious options. While modern agricultural practices and transportation allow for year-round availability of many vegetables, the flavor complexity achieved during peak season remains unmatched, emphasizing the value of seasonal eating.

3. Nutritional Value

Late summer vegetables offer a dense source of essential vitamins, minerals, and antioxidants, crucial for maintaining optimal health. These nutrients contribute to various physiological functions, supporting everything from immune system strength to cellular repair. Understanding the specific nutritional profiles of these vegetables allows for informed dietary choices that maximize health benefits.

  • Vitamin and Mineral Content

    Many late summer vegetables are rich in vitamins A and C, vital for immune function and skin health. Examples include bell peppers, which provide significant amounts of vitamin C, and carrots, rich in beta-carotene, a precursor to vitamin A. Mineral content also varies, with vegetables like spinach offering iron and potassium. These micronutrients contribute to overall well-being and disease prevention.

  • Antioxidant Properties

    Antioxidants protect cells from damage caused by free radicals, unstable molecules linked to aging and chronic diseases. Tomatoes are an excellent source of lycopene, a powerful antioxidant associated with reduced cancer risk. Other late summer vegetables, like squash and eggplant, contain various antioxidants that contribute to cellular health and protection against oxidative stress. Consuming a variety of these vegetables ensures a diverse intake of beneficial antioxidants.

  • Fiber Content

    Dietary fiber plays a critical role in digestive health, promoting regularity and preventing constipation. Late summer vegetables like corn and green beans are good sources of fiber, contributing to a healthy gut microbiome and overall digestive well-being. Adequate fiber intake also supports healthy cholesterol levels and blood sugar regulation.

  • Hydration

    Many late summer vegetables have high water content, contributing to daily hydration needs. Cucumbers, zucchini, and celery are particularly hydrating, helping maintain fluid balance, especially during warmer months. Proper hydration supports numerous bodily functions, including temperature regulation and nutrient absorption.

4. Preservation Opportunities

Preservation techniques offer a crucial bridge between the abundance of late summer harvests and the leaner months that follow. Historically, these methods ensured sustenance throughout the year, and they continue to provide valuable benefits today, from reducing food waste to extending the enjoyment of seasonal flavors. The convergence of abundant harvests and the need to preserve this bounty for later consumption has shaped culinary traditions and food preservation practices across cultures.

Several methods offer effective ways to preserve late summer vegetables. Canning, a process involving sealing food in airtight jars after heating, is suitable for tomatoes, which can be transformed into sauces and salsas, and for pickling cucumbers and other vegetables. Freezing, another common method, preserves the nutritional value and flavor of vegetables like corn, peas, and beans. Dehydration, through air drying or using a dehydrator, removes moisture, concentrating flavors and extending shelf life for vegetables like tomatoes and peppers, which can later be rehydrated in soups and stews. Root cellaring, an ancient technique of storing vegetables in a cool, dark, and humid environment, is ideal for extending the shelf life of potatoes, carrots, and other root vegetables through the winter.

Understanding these preservation techniques empowers individuals to maximize the value of late summer harvests. These methods not only minimize food waste but also offer economic advantages by reducing reliance on out-of-season produce. Preserving seasonal flavors allows for year-round enjoyment of peak-season tastes, enhancing culinary experiences and promoting dietary diversity. These practices contribute to a more sustainable food system by reducing reliance on energy-intensive transportation and storage methods associated with imported or out-of-season produce.

Question 1: How can one distinguish between early and late summer varieties?

Distinct characteristics differentiate early and late summer crops. Late-season varieties often exhibit deeper colorations, richer flavors, and larger sizes. Harvest timing specified on seed packets and local gardening resources provide further guidance.

Question 2: What are optimal storage methods for extending freshness?

Proper storage is crucial for maintaining quality. Cool, dry, and dark environments are ideal for most varieties. Specific requirements vary; for instance, tomatoes benefit from storage at room temperature, while leafy greens require refrigeration in airtight containers.

Question 3: Which preservation methods best retain nutritional value?

Freezing generally preserves the highest nutrient content, followed closely by canning. Dehydration, while effective for extending shelf life, can result in some nutrient loss. Blanching before freezing further enhances nutrient retention.

Question 4: Are there specific culinary techniques best suited for these crops?

The versatility of late summer produce lends itself to diverse culinary applications. Grilling enhances the sweetness of corn and peppers, while roasting intensifies the flavors of root vegetables. Incorporating them into salads, soups, stews, and stir-fries offers further culinary possibilities.

Tips for Maximizing the Late Summer Harvest

The following tips provide guidance on optimizing the selection, utilization, and preservation of produce during the late summer harvest season.

Tip 1: Frequent Harvesting: Regular harvesting encourages continuous production. For crops like zucchini, beans, and tomatoes, frequent picking prevents over-ripening and promotes further fruit development. This ensures a consistent supply of tender, flavorful vegetables throughout the season’s duration.

Tip 2: Ripening Techniques: Not all vegetables achieve peak ripeness on the vine. Tomatoes, for example, can continue ripening indoors, particularly varieties harvested slightly green. Placing them in a paper bag with a banana accelerates the ripening process due to ethylene gas released by the banana.

Tip 3: Blanching Before Freezing: Blanching, a brief immersion in boiling water followed by an ice bath, deactivates enzymes that cause quality degradation during freezing. This process helps preserve the color, texture, and nutritional value of vegetables like beans and peas, ensuring optimal quality upon thawing.

Tip 4: Proper Storage: Appropriate storage extends the shelf life of harvested vegetables. Store most vegetables in cool, dark, and dry environments. Refrigeration is suitable for leafy greens and herbs, while root vegetables benefit from storage in a cool, dark cellar or pantry.

Tip 5: Exploring Diverse Culinary Applications: Late summer vegetables offer exceptional culinary versatility. Incorporate them into salads, soups, stews, stir-fries, and grilled dishes. Experimenting with different cooking methods and flavor combinations expands culinary horizons.

Tip 6: Prioritize Preservation: Preserve surplus harvests to minimize food waste and extend enjoyment throughout the year. Canning, freezing, pickling, and drying offer various preservation methods, each suited to specific types of produce. Select appropriate methods based on intended use and available resources.

Tip 7: Support Local Farmers: Seek out locally grown produce from farmers’ markets and community-supported agriculture programs. This directly supports local economies and reduces environmental impact associated with transportation and large-scale commercial agriculture.

Tip 8: Succession Planting: Extend the harvest season by staggering plantings of quick-maturing crops like lettuce, radishes, and spinach. This technique ensures a continuous supply of fresh produce throughout late summer and into early fall.
